Elizabeth Bowes-Lyon (4 August 1900 - 30 March 2002) was the Queen consort of King George VI from 1936 until her husband's death in 1952, after which she was known as Queen Elizabeth The Queen Mother, to avoid confusion with her daughter Queen Elizabeth II.

Queen Elizabeth I of England lived in many different residences during her lifetime. During the reigns of her siblings, her main residence was at Hatfield, though she did for a time live with Henry VIII's last wife, Katherine, at Chelsea. I believe her first residence after her accession to the throne was Whitehall. Elizabeth I lived in Greenwich Palace.
